Does Pre-Workout Give You A Buzz? Pre-workout will give you a buzz if it has enough caffeine to exceed your tolerance. Most of them do unless you live off caffeine. The buzz is attributed to the amount of caffeine in the pre-workout.

How Late Is Too Late For Pre-Workout? As the half-life of caffeine lasts approximately up to 6 hours, taking pre-workout within 6 hours of your typical bed time is too late. For example, if you go to bed at 10 pm, you wouldn’t take pre-workout from 4 pm or later.
